This is not, in any way, a Wampserver problem.
You add extensions without knowing what you're doing, you add two identical dlls, one _ts_ and the other _nts_ without having any idea what it is.
With PHP, under Windows, you only need _ts_ which means thread safe.
Check with SQL Server what the procedures are.
